Grammar usage guide and real-world examples

USAGE SUMMARY

The phrase "mice were grafted"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used in scientific or medical contexts, particularly when discussing experiments involving the transplantation of tissues or cells into mice. Example: "In the study, mice were grafted with human tissue to observe the effects of the treatment."

Expert writing Tips

Best practice

When describing the grafting procedure, specify the type of tissue or cells being grafted and the location of the graft on the mouse. For example, "Mice were grafted with tumor cells on the left flank."

Common error

Avoid using the term "grafted" interchangeably with "implanted" or "injected" if the specific procedure is a graft. "Grafting" implies a more substantial tissue transplant, while "implantation" and "injection" might refer to other methods of introducing substances or cells.

FAQs

How is "mice were grafted" used in scientific writing?

In scientific writing, "mice were grafted" indicates a surgical procedure where tissue or cells are transplanted into mice for research purposes. For example, "Mice were grafted with human tumor cells to study cancer progression."

What are some alternatives to "mice were grafted"?

You can use alternatives like "mice received grafts", "mice underwent grafting", or "grafts were performed on mice depending on the context and emphasis you want to convey.

Is it correct to say "mice was grafted" instead of "mice were grafted"?

No, "mice was grafted" is grammatically incorrect. "Mice" is a plural noun, so it requires the plural verb form "were". The correct phrase is "mice were grafted".

What's the difference between "mice were grafted with" and "mice were implanted with"?

"Mice were grafted with" typically refers to transplanting living tissue that is expected to integrate with the host, while "mice were implanted with" can refer to the insertion of either living tissue or non-living materials.
